Hide assigned tasks that are depended on predecessors

  • May 9, 2025
  • 1 reply
  • 221 views

Description - Do not make assigned tasks that are depended on predecessors visible

 

Why is this feature important to you - Do no want to confuse assigned users if the tasks are not needed or ready to be worked on. But want to be able to assign the tasks in a task template so that it is a part of the task structure/workflow.

 

How would you like the feature to work - We would like to assign a particular designer to tasks in a task template so that when a project is opened and the task template is attached, the tasks are pre-populated. If the tasks are not needed, the owner can delete the tasks, but if revisions are required, we want to make sure those tasks are assigned and made active once the preceding tasks are marked complete.

 

Current Behaviour - All tasks with and without predecessors that are preassigned in the task template and used in a project are visible up in the designer's My Task and My Work lists.

@jennywi In the My Work widget, there is a checkbox filter to remove the Not Ready tasks.

Otherwise, you can address this yourself by building and sharing a filter at the task level. Specifically apply a wildcard filter so that any user who toggles the filter on will see things filtered for their needs and not someone else's. It also heavily simplifies your filter build to be more universal.
